The Essential Features in A Fruitful Alcohol Intervention
What are the necessary factors in a fruitful alcohol intervention? Why do some alcoholism interventions succeed as anticipated while others flop?
The Necessity for a Time-Honored Reputation of Intervention Achievement
Scientific study reveals that a successful alcoholism intervention needs to be overseen by an intervention professional who has a recognized reputation of intervention attainment.
Fundamentally this means that instead of making a choice for a “normal” alcohol dependency therapist or psychotherapist for an alcohol addiction intervention, the individual who is hand picked to administer the intervention needs to be trained in substance abuse intervention techniques and needs to display a reputation of “winning” alcoholism interventions.
A Few Uncomplicated Examples of The Best Time For an Alcoholism Intervention
Scientific examination and alcoholism facts about interventions has also demonstrated that the most worthwhile time for an alcoholism intervention is following a noteworthy occasion in the life of the alcoholic or abusive drinker. The following represents a few illustrations of these types of noteworthy happenings:
- The alcohol dependent individual or alcohol abuser has been caught stealing something of significance.
- The abusive drinker or alcohol-dependent person has been caught lying about something of significance.
- The alcohol addicted person or alcohol abuser has been placed behind bars for a DWI or DUI.
In situations such as these, the alcohol addicted individual or alcohol abuser is more apt to feel apologetic or to be embarrassed, therefore making him or her more interested in getting the professional alcohol rehab that is required.
At this juncture, additionally, it is also essential to highlight the fact that the abusive drinker or alcohol-dependent person needs to be free of alcohol during the alcohol addiction intervention. Everything considered, if the abusive drinker or alcohol addicted person is drunk during an alcohol addiction intervention, failure is virtually certain.
Furthermore, scientific research has also made obvious the fact that the abusive drinker or alcohol addicted individual has to at least try to listen to what is communicated in an alcohol abuse intervention. Stated more clearly, during an alcohol abuse intervention, the alcohol abuser or alcohol addicted individual needs to listen to what his or her drinking problems have done to those who care for him or her the most.
The Necessity of Alcohol Counseling For the Irresponsible Drinker
And finally, scientific exploration shows that the main reason for an alcohol dependency intervention in the first place is to encourage the hazardous drinker or alcohol-dependent person to get the quality alcohol therapy he or she needs. Stated more explicitly, even if the individual who supervises the intervention has a superlative profile of fruitful interventions and even if the alcohol abuser or alcoholic sincerely listens to every single word that is mentioned all the way through an intervention, if the alcohol abuser or alcohol dependent individual is not stimulated to request quality alcoholism therapy after the alcohol intervention, then the intervention will be a fiasco.
Evidently all of these factors are needed for a successful alcohol addiction intervention. If, conversely, the abusive drinker or alcohol-dependent person is not stirred to ask for alcohol dependency rehabilitation after listening to his or her family members put into words the grief, anger, and displeasure they feel about the abusive drinker’s or alcohol dependent individual’s thoughtless drinking behavior and the care they feel for the problem drinker, then every other facet of the alcohol dependency intervention will to a large extent be unimportant.
Even Productive Alcohol Dependency Interventions Can Boomerang In the Long Term
It also needs to be pointed out that regardless of the fact that the alcoholism intervention can be seen as fruitful in that it helped put the hazardous drinker or alcohol addicted person in a more “open” attitude and frankly helped the alcohol addicted individual or hazardous drinker decide upon the fact that he or she needed alcohol counseling or professional help for alcoholism or alcohol abuse, the plain fact that the intervention transpired might result in bitterness, anger, and mistrust in the future.
To put it briefly, even when addiction interventions are seen as effective in the short term, in the long term, alternatively, they may go wrong and, thus, might make the family and/or the alcohol dependent person’s situation even worse than it was before the alcoholism intervention was initiated.
No matter how unfair or paradoxical this seems, try to keep in mind that it is basically one of the main alcohol facts that has to be addressed when engaging in an alcohol intervention.
